Overview

Miodrag Bolic is affiliated with the University of Ottawa in Canada. Their research spans multiple fields including Medicine, Engineering, and Computer Science with a significant focus on Biomedical Engineering,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, and Surgery among other subfields.

Their work primarily addresses topics such as Non-Invasive Vital Sign Monitoring, Hemodynamic Monitoring and Therapy, Heart Rate Variability and Autonomic Control, Viral Infectious Diseases and Gene Expression in Insects, ECG Monitoring and Analysis, Virus-based Gene Therapy Research, and Cardiovascular Health and Disease Prevention.
